I don't think so.

#1 by far get lost/injured and succumb to hypothermia or lack of water or injuries.

Get directly killed in accident (fall, drowning, blood loss)

homicide

Distant #4 Animals (bear / cougar) or suicide

many many many are hypothermia this is why they often find people's clothes scattered all over the place and nothing else. You tend to think you are burning up at end stage hypothermia and strip your clothes off.
